Confused about Eagle PC-CB sizing
 
Hey folks,

As I understand it the sizing for the Eagle CIRAS is based upon the size of SAPI plate the carrier is built to carry. Though in the L/XL phantom Ciras, the cumberbund seems to be longer, allowing for a better fit of larger folks. Is this mirrored in the Eagle PC-CB? Is this phenomenon limited to Phantom reproductions?

Eddie July 24th, 2007 23:11

I own a Eagle CIRAS (small) it fits Medium SAPI plates but the vest inner/outter cummerbund can accommodate folks much larger say 6'+ 200lbs. Owned the Eagle PC-CB in small found it too small at times with plates & soft armor.

CIRAS cummerbund is held together with the QR cable and PC-CB is held together with paracord in a shoelace crisscross pattern and held in place with a cordlock.

Zeke July 24th, 2007 23:21

I do believe that the first run of PCs from Eagle that came with cummerbunds had them all the same size regardless of what size PC you ordered. I do believe the L/XL versions now have longer cummerbunds as well. Not sure if the Phantom ones are the same, I'd imagine they are though.
